India’s power ministry content with capacity addition
India’s Ministry of Power is content that the final 11th Plan capacity addition is likely to be 250 per cent of that actually achieved in the 10th Plan.
It considers it a very big achievement.
The target of 78,000 MW-worth of fresh capacity addition for the 11th Plan was scaled down, due to non-performance, to 62,000 MW.
The ministry opined that such unrealistic target-setting should persist because it apparently facilitates a large number of power projects to benefit at least in the subsequent Five Year Plan.
